First and foremost, 3D laser scanning is a way to capture the world around us. It is like taking a snapshot or photo, but with depth. It is usually done for the purpose of 3d modeling. 3D laser scanning has found its way into popular culture, see in example this scene from the movie Prometheus.There is also a reality show called Time Scanners that features …

The 3D laser scanning technology [14] will encourage users to record buildings that may be inaccessible due to safety hazards. Therefore, user safety is ensured when investigating dangerous areas due to terrain or toxic conditions. The speed at which 3D scanners collect data also reduces users' time in contact in these conditions.Integrating 3D laser scanning into the workflow . Laser scanners play a key role in quality assurance. 3D digital capture of shapes and surfaces using lasers is an effortless and precise process. The industry uses laser scanners primarily for the quality control of geometries and surface, but also for reverse engineering, fit and finish, and assembly applications.

Within the field of 3D object scanning, laser scanning (also …3D laser scanning is a specific type of 3D scanning technology that employs lasers to measure distances and create a highly accurate and detailed 3D representation …A 3D scanner is a non-contact, non-destructive digital device that uses a light/laser source to accurately capture the shape of a physical object into computer-aided design (CAD) data. It generates a point cloud or a set of data points in a coordinate system that accurately depicts a physical object's size and shape.

Within the field of 3D object scanning, laser scanning (also …How to Create a 3D CAD Model from a Laser Scanner. Our first step was to make a site visit and start scanning. By setting the scanner up in six different locations we were able to collect the necessary number of points for the detail level we were after. Each scan took approximately six minutes and due to the number of flat surfaces, targets ...Laser scanning is a powerful technique for creating accurate and detailed 3D models from physical objects.
